This is detail from Longines watches..But I don't know how much it could actually be sold for? The serial number 18.127.472 identifies a wristwatch in Gold with the reference 9584. It is fitted with a Longines manufacture caliber 805 that was first produced in 1963. It was invoiced to Messrs.� Mohammed Abdullah Al-Batel, who were for many years our agent for Kuwait, in July 1977. Your watch doesn�t have a model name. |
